Make the collection instructions specific

Ask the supplier for the released order reference, collection entrance and contact. Confirm the number of packages and the time they will be ready for handoff. Your sales confirmation should not be used as a substitute for warehouse readiness.

A Creston business may arrange collection from a supplier elsewhere, or send an order outward from its own premises. In either direction, state both addresses. The courier quote should describe the full movement you are purchasing.

Describe the goods in their transport packaging

Use the finished carton dimensions and weights, including any protective case. Explain long, fragile or awkward packages separately. If the order requires a pallet, identify its complete dimensions and unloading requirements.

Coordinate business hours across the whole route

Obtain the supplier’s release window and the receiver’s availability, and state the local date and time at each end when an appointment matters. Cross-region delivery planning should not rely on an ambiguous note such as “before four.”

Tell WTM the latest useful arrival time and the date required. The agreed service establishes the commitment for that route. An urgent order, a planned customer delivery and a repeating replenishment shipment may need different arrangements.

Give the receiver a usable handoff plan

Provide the business name, receiving contact and actual entrance. Where a property is outside the built-up town area, give the exact location and access instructions rather than just “Creston.”

For example, an order going to a workshop on a rural property needs a different handoff description from a carton accepted at a retail counter. The point is not the type of business; it is making the receiving location findable and available.
